Hi,

Just tried to download speed camera database to my Go 500 but its telling me that the disk is full after 3 of the 4 files are copied. The ones that I copied ok are :-

pocketgps_uk_pmobile.ov2
pocketgps_uk_pmobile.bmp
pocketgps_uk_sc.bmp

but not pocketgps_uk_sc.ov2

Is there anything I can safely remove from the disk to create enough space or would it be better to copy only the pmobile or sc files?

Thanks (in advance)

Only things that it is safe to delete would be those things that you have put on. Wink

Doesn't the Go 500 do everything on an SD card (from the mapping point of view)? So the solution would be to buy a larger SD card, transfer the current card contents to the new card and try again. This would best be done by using a PC with card reader and making sure you set Windows up to display hidden files. His way you also get a backup copy of your card - which you should have just in case.

I think this is possible - I've done it a few times with TT Navigator (5 and 6) maps without issue. Any one care to comment?

Indeed it is possible. There's full instructions in the TomTom FAQs topic, which is a "sticky" at the top of the TomTom Go/Rider/One forum section (FAQ #8 IIRC).

You COULD try deleting some of the foreign navigation voices (from the preferences menu), to make a bit more room, but as the unit uses spare SD card space as virtual memory while working out routes, it would be best to do as suggested and get a bigger SD card. Also you get to keep the old one as another backup of the important stuff.
Get a known brand card from Sandisk or Kingston rather than the cheapest you can find. It needs to be "fast" speed (but not "ultra" and 2GB is the largest I'd recommend as most 4GB cards use a different technology which is incompatible.
